The two best known Portuguese people in England will be allowing their images to be used to promote Algarve tourism there. José Mourinho and Cristiano Ronaldo will be spearheading the international launching of the Allgarve brand in London. The manager will thus be repeating the experience of promoting Portugal in England, following the campaign by the Portuguese Tourism Institute with APCOR and ICEP to promote Portuguese cork in the British market.
Adversaries on the pitch – Chelsea has just lost the Premiership to Manchester - Mourinho and Ronaldo are promising to give their support to an event that will present the brand created by the government to promote the Algarve abroad, even after the fiery exchange of words between the two little more than a week ago.
The highlight of the ceremony will be the transformation of the garden of a London hotel into a golf course, where the Portugal Master's will be promoted. Another of the products that will the subject of close attention will be tourism connected with the sea, though the presentation of the Portuguese leg of the Breitling Med Cup which will have the Portimão Marina as its support base.
The Allgarve brand, which is part of a three million euro programme for the development of tourism in the region, and was announced by Minister Manuel Pinho in March, is intended to include a series of events in different areas with the aim of “offering memorable experiences”.
The idea of the brand is to reflect diversity, glamour and credibility, and is accompanied by the slogan “experiences of a lifetime” in a programme which will last for at least three years, according to those responsible for the sector in government.
Concerts by Lou Reed and Norah Jones on golf courses, nights with DJs, jazz sessions, exhibitions and sporting events that are international in scope, are on the list of initiatives.
After London, the brand, which is promoted by Turismo de Portugal and by the Algarve Promotion Bureau (ATA), will be presented in Madrid (23rd May) and in Moscow (28th and 29th May). source: algarve observer |
